Jabil is seeking an experienced Email Marketing Manager to be able to own and optimize our customers and lead-nurturing programs.

How will you make an impact?  As the Email Marketing Manager, you will play a key role in developing personalized campaigns, primarily via email, and leveraging other channels to drive long-term relationships, engagement, and conversion.  The Email Marketing Manager will design, execute, and optimize nurturing campaigns to engage leads and customers at different stages of the buyer’s journey. The role will focus on creating compelling email marketing programs, managing customer lifecycle stages, and exploring multi-channel strategies to enhance engagement. You’ll work closely with sales, business unit leaders, and other teams to deliver personalized and value-driven messaging to prospects and existing customers.


What will you do?      

  • Email Marketing Campaigns: Design, develop, and manage automated email campaigns that nurture leads and customers, focusing on personalized messaging to increase engagement and conversions.

  • Customer Journey Mapping: Create and optimize segmented email lists and workflows based on buyer personas, ensuring personalized content delivery at each stage of the customer journey.

  • Cross-Channel Nurturing: Implement nurturing programs across other relevant channels, such as telephone, SMS, and WhatsApp, to ensure a cohesive experience across touchpoints and continuity throughout the marketing calendar.

  • Analytics & Performance: Track, analyze, and report on key performance metrics (open rates, click-through rates, conversions) to continuously improve campaigns and refine segmentation strategies.

  • Conversion Optimization: Conduct A/B testing on email content, subject lines, designs, and call-to-actions to identify the most effective approaches for lead engagement.

  • Opportunistic Targeting: Utilize trending topics, news, and/or global events to create timely engagements that resonate with the target audience

  • Content Development: Collaborate with content teams to develop compelling email copy, subject lines, and creative assets that resonate with target audiences.

  • Lead Scoring & Qualification: Collaborate with the sales team to refine lead scoring models and ensure that nurturing efforts prioritize high-potential leads.

  • Continuous Engagement: Ensure the content and nurturing program also continuously engages with existing customers, creating business expansion opportunities for the sales team
